Output 64e80c9d05f8885b933953443016ec973538ae81d542fcdb8d4009b07730f544:48

value
18923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68d5c6f9e598000d0c897bcfa22e3e281da4120d OP_EQUAL
address
3BFLHzqA1FcQYrdiDbHsPFtRocDkrjT76h
transaction
64e80c9d05f8885b933953443016ec973538ae81d542fcdb8d4009b07730f544